Qualcomm Makes MobileHistory: Upcoming Snapdragon 8 Elite Gen 6 Chip Officially Reaches 5GHz
Qualcomm is preparing to redefine high-end smartphone performance with its next-generation processor, the Qualcomm Oryon CPU. Targeted at future flagship smartphones and premium foldables, this custom silicon marks a major industry milestone: it is the first mobile processor designed to hit unprecedented clock speeds of 5GHz.
Breaking the 5GHz Thermal Barrier
Achieving a 5GHz clock speed within tight mobile thermal limits requires profound architectural shifts. To bypass traditional silicon limitations, Qualcomm designed a fully custom microarchitecture. This design pairs raw clock speeds with higher instructions per clock, delivering swift real-world responsiveness and highly efficient sustained performance without overheating.

Rethinking Memory with Oryon FlexCache
- Modern, data-heavy mobile applications generate massive datasets that can easily choke standard system memory. To address this bottleneck, Qualcomm heavily redesigned its tiered cache memory system:
- Oryon FlexCache: A dynamic architecture that allows different CPU cores to access a single, flexible memory pool.
- Real-Time Allocation: Memory capacity shifts dynamically based on active task demands, keeping vital data in fast internal memory.
- Generous L1 Caches: Integrated directly into each core to drastically reduce system latency.
- Large L2 Cache Complex: Works alongside L1 caches to cut down pipeline stalls and ensure quick access for continuous processing.

Optimising for Next-Gen AI and Gaming
These hardware upgrades specifically target critical areas of the modern premium smartphone experience:
- Autonomous AI Agents: The shared cache pool ensures incredibly smooth handovers and minimizes latency as complex tasks move between performance and efficiency cores.
- AAA Mobile Gaming: Localized cache data stabilizes frame pacing, preventing frustrating micro-stutters during intense graphics rendering for smoother action.
- High-Resolution Video Editing: Media pipelines can pass frame buffers directly within the CPU cache, bypassing main RAM bandwidth constraints and extending battery life during exports.
This breakthrough custom architecture is expected to debut in the Snapdragon 8 Elite Gen 6 platform. Qualcomm will reveal exactly how this 5GHz processing technology will reshape premium global smartphones at the annual Snapdragon Summit on 22 September 2026.
